Gamhariya Population - Gaya, Bihar

Gamhariya is a medium size village located in Dobhi Block of Gaya district, Bihar with total 71 families residing. The Gamhariya village has population of 484 of which 251 are males while 233 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Gamhariya village population of children with age 0-6 is 109 which makes up 22.52 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Gamhariya village is 928 which is higher than Bihar state average of 918. Child Sex Ratio for the Gamhariya as per census is 817, lower than Bihar average of 935.

Gamhariya village has lower literacy rate compared to Bihar. In 2011, literacy rate of Gamhariya village was 42.40 % compared to 61.80 % of Bihar. In Gamhariya Male literacy stands at 54.97 % while female literacy rate was 29.35 %.

Caste Factor

In Gamhariya village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 74.17 % of total population in Gamhariya village. The village Gamhariya curr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Gamhariya village out of total population, 261 were engaged in work activities. 71.26 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 28.74 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 261 workers engaged in Main Work, 3 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 178 were Agricultural labourer.
